Helmut Eller <eller.helmut <at> gmail.com> writes:
> I use git to manage some files (.emacs, .bashrc etc.) in my home
> directory and hg for a project in a directory named ~/lisp/slime/.
> I have both, a ~/.git and a ~/lisp/slime/.hg directory
> and my ~/.gitignore contains a line with: lisp*
>
> However when I invoke C-x v d on ~/lisp/slime, a buffer
> pops up with the first (wrong) line: VC backend : Git
> and lists most of the files from the ~/lisp/slime directory
> as "unregistered". Obviously, I would prefer to use the hg backend
> for the ~/lisp/slime directory.
>
> On the other hand: if I open a file in ~/lisp/slime the modeline
> correctly displays hg and commands like C-x v l or C-x v = correctly
> use the hg backend.
There's a generic workaround for problems like this: use
C-u C-x v d
to start vc-dir, it will prompt for the VC backend to use.
